The video introduces Pixel Diffusion (PD), a new open-source AI model developed by Nvidia that excels at generating and upscaling images to 4K resolution. PD is notable for its speed, producing detailed images in under five seconds, and its lightweight design. Unlike traditional image generators that decode images from compressed latent spaces, PD operates directly in pixel space, allowing it to produce sharper, more detailed images with fewer artifacts. The presenter demonstrates PD’s capabilities by upscaling various images, including a tiger, a cityscape, a portrait, and a night sky, highlighting the significant improvements in detail and clarity compared to the original low-resolution images.

The video compares PD with other leading upscaling methods, particularly Seed VR2, showing that PD consistently delivers higher quality, sharper, and more faithful results. PD also outperforms Seed VR2 in speed, being up to 5.9 times faster, making it one of the best options for generating high-resolution images quickly and efficiently. The presenter emphasizes PD’s consistency and coherence in maintaining image details even when zoomed in, which is a common challenge for other upscalers.

Next, the tutorial covers how to install and run PD locally using Comfy UI, a popular platform for running open-source image and video generators offline. The presenter walks through updating Comfy UI, downloading necessary workflows and models, and setting up the environment. Three workflows are introduced: a simple text-to-image generator producing 1K images, an image upscaler that converts existing images to 2K or 4K, and a combined workflow that generates images with models like Z image or Flux and then upscales them using PD. Detailed instructions are provided for downloading and configuring models, including text encoders, diffusion models, and VAEs.

The presenter demonstrates using the O2 workflow to upscale an existing image, explaining how to adjust image dimensions and select appropriate models for optimal results. They also show how to compare before and after images side-by-side within Comfy UI to appreciate the improvements. The video further explores generating images from scratch using Z image or Flux models before upscaling with PD, highlighting the speed and quality of the combined approach. An additional simple text-to-image workflow is mentioned but noted as less impressive due to its 1K resolution limit and lower image quality.
